Factors that Affect Gold Rate  

In Mumbai, Gold prices much like the other regions, are influenced by a diverse range of global and local factors. To comprehend the fluctuations in gold rates in Mumbai, it is crucial to understand the key drivers that shape the gold market dynamics in the city. 

Global economic indicators play a significant role in determining gold prices. During periods of economic strength and optimism, investors tend to shift their focus toward riskier assets, leading to a decrease in gold demand and subsequently lower gold prices. Conversely, in times of economic uncertainty, geopolitical tensions, or financial crises, investors often turn to gold as a safe haven investment, driving up its price. 

The strength of the Indian rupee against the US dollar is another crucial factor affecting gold rates in Mumbai. Since gold is internationally traded in US dollars, any fluctuations in the value of the rupee can directly impact gold prices. If the rupee depreciates against the dollar, the cost of importing gold increases, leading to higher gold rates in Mumbai. 

The demand and supply dynamics within Mumbai’s gold market also play a significant role in determining gold rates. Cultural factors, festive seasons, weddings, and auspicious occasions contribute to the strong demand for gold jewelry in the city. During these periods, the demand for gold typically surges, causing prices to rise. Conversely, a surplus of gold in the market or a decrease in consumer demand can result in lower gold rates. 

In addition to these factors, global events, economic policies, interest rate changes, and geopolitical developments can create volatility in the gold market, leading to fluctuations in gold rates.

Historical Trends of Mumbai  gold rate today

Historical gold rate trends provide valuable insights into the gold market in Mumbai. Over the past few years, Mumbai has witnessed a steady increase in gold prices. For instance, in 2018, the gold rate was around Rs. 30,000 per 10 grams, and by 2020, it had surged past Rs. 40,000 per 10 grams. The COVID-19 pandemic played a significant role in driving up gold prices as investors turned to gold as a safe haven during uncertain times. 

However, in 2021, the gold rate in Mumbai has experienced a slight decline compared to the previous year. In January 2021, the gold rate stood at approximately Rs. 51,000 per 10 grams, indicating a decrease from the previous year’s peak. Several factors, including the global vaccine rollout, economic stabilization, and increasing interest rates, have contributed to the drop in gold prices. Where to Buy Gold in Mumbai and Important Considerations?  

Mumbai, renowned for its vibrant gold and jewelry market, offers a wide range of options for buyers. When purchasing gold in Mumbai, it is crucial to consider certain factors to ensure a secure and satisfactory buying experience. 

First and foremost, it is advisable to buy gold from reputable and well-established jewelers. Look for jewelers who are members of renowned industry associations and have a longstanding reputation for delivering quality and authentic gold. This helps minimize the risk of purchasing counterfeit or substandard gold. 

Secondly, consider the purity of the gold. Gold is typically measured in karats, with 24 karats being the purest form. The purity of gold directly affects its price, with higher-purity gold commanding a premium. Ensure that the gold you purchase is certified and hallmarked by a recognized assaying center to guarantee its purity. 

Furthermore, exploring investment options like Gold ETFs (Exchange-Traded Funds) can be advantageous. Gold ETFs offer a convenient and liquid method to invest in gold through the stock market. They enable investors to track the price of gold investments without the need for physical storage. Gold ETFs provide flexibility and ease of trading, making them an attractive choice for investors in Mumbai. 

Additionally, online platforms that facilitate digital gold investments have emerged as a convenient and cost-effective way to invest in gold. Digital gold allows investors to purchase and sell gold in smaller denominations, making gold accessible to a broader audience. These platforms ensure transparency, security, and seamless transactions, making them a viable option for gold investment in Mumbai.

Gold Investment Options Other Than Physical Gold   

  • Investors in Mumbai have several options to invest in gold beyond physical ownership. Gold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s) are a popular choice as they track the price of gold and can be bought and sold on stock exchanges like shares. 
  • Gold Mutual Funds provide diversification by investing in gold-related assets such as mining company stocks or gold ETFs. 
  • Investing in Gold Mining Stocks offers exposure to the growth and profitability of the mining industry. Experienced investors can trade Gold Futures and Options contracts, speculating on future price movements. 
  • Gold Accumulation Plans allow investors to regularly invest fixed amounts to accumulate gold over time, held by banks or financial institutions. 
  • Gold Certificates, issued by banks or financial institutions, represent ownership of a specific amount of gold without physical possession. These investment options provide flexibility and diversification for investors interested in the gold market in Mumbai.
